 *   Forum: [Fixing WordPress](https://wordpress.org/support/forum/how-to-and-troubleshooting/)
   
   In reply to: [Changing Usernames?](https://wordpress.org/support/topic/changing-usernames/)
 *  [DavyB](https://wordpress.org/support/users/davyb/)
 * (@davyb)
 * [14 years, 4 months ago](https://wordpress.org/support/topic/changing-usernames/#post-2435618)
 * [@geeb10](https://wordpress.org/support/users/geeb10/) you are hosted at wordpress.
   com you should be asking wordpress.com specific questions at forums.wordpress.
   com NOT wordpress.org/support, although the answers are extremely similar.
    You
   should simply change you display name NOT you username. If you were self-hosted
   or on paid hosting and have access to your database the username can be altered
   using database editing tools – which is often required to change the default 
   to something other than “admin” – the default when you setup with hosting under
   your control.
